Brouillon de traduction automatique (French) for "Memory Capacity Forecast": Memory Capacity Forecast is a compute planning model that estimates future resource needs for volatile runtime storage. It uses traffic history, growth assumptions, and utilization trends so teams can avoid surprise shortages while keeping evidence, reliability, and public-safe operational boundaries clear.
